In case 17525/2024 between TATA CAPITAL LIMITED and BIJU SREENIVASAN, the Lok Adalath bench closed the complaint as settled on 14.03.2026 after the complainant's counsel filed a settlement memo. Consequently, the accused was acquitted of the offence under Section 138 of the Negotiable Instruments Act.
